What is "unguent"?

Unguent refers to a topical product or ointment that is used to soothe, moisturize, or protect the skin. It is commonly applied to alleviate dryness, irritation, or minor skin conditions, providing a nourishing and protective barrier. Unguents often contain emollient ingredients that help to hydrate and soften the skin, promoting its health and well-being.

What is a "frieze"?

A frieze is a decorative band or panel that runs along the upper part of a wall, often found in buildings and interiors. This feature is typically adorned with various designs, such as carvings, paintings, or reliefs, showcasing artistic themes or patterns. Friezes can be made from different materials, including plaster, wood, or stone, and are used to enhance the visual appeal of a space. They serve as a decorative element that adds character and elegance, helping to draw the eye and create a sense of height in the room or structure.

What is a "treatise"?

A treatise is a formal and detailed written work that explores a specific subject or topic in depth. It is typically scholarly in nature and provides a thorough examination, analysis, and explanation of the subject matter. A treatise is often structured logically, with clear arguments and evidence supporting the author's conclusions. It is usually longer than an article or essay and is intended to contribute to the academic or intellectual understanding of the subject. Treatises are commonly found in fields such as philosophy, law, science, or history.

What is a "stanza"?

A stanza is a grouped set of lines in a poem, often separated from other stanzas by a blank line. Stanzas function similarly to paragraphs in prose, organizing thoughts and ideas into distinct sections. They can vary in length, structure, and rhyme scheme, allowing poets to create different effects and rhythms within their work. The arrangement of stanzas contributes to the overall flow and visual presentation of a poem, helping to guide the reader's experience and enhance the thematic elements of the piece.
